Intuit Increases Dividend The company also recently declared a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Friday, October 17th. Shareholders of record on Thursday, October 9th will be given a dividend of $1.20 per share. This represents a $4.80 annualized dividend and a yield of 0.7%. This is an increase from Intuit's previous quarterly dividend of $1.04. The ex-dividend date of this dividend is Thursday, October 9th. Intuit's payout ratio is currently 30.28%. Intuit Company Profile ( Free Report ) Intuit Inc provides financial management and compliance products and services for consumers, small businesses, self-employed, and accounting professionals in the United States, Canada, and internationally. The company operates in four segments: Small Business & Self-Employed, Consumer, Credit Karma, and ProTax.
